I am a US citizen living/working abroad. What form am I to fill out?
You use the form 1040 ....
If you do not have a IRS W-2 from a foreign company then you do not enter the form you received in the W-2 section. You enter the income as Foreign Earned Income.
· Click on Federal Taxes
· Click on Wages and Income
· Click on I'll choose what I work on
· Scroll down to Less Common Income
· On Foreign Earned Income and Exclusion, click the start or update button
